Still a lot of meat in that skeletonized tang.... kinda surprised that it wasn't a bit leaner under there. This is a GOOD thing.

any closer to the edges than 5/32" and you're weakening the knife, so I'd expect that plus a little margin, plus extra material around the first bolt-hole, which is in the high-stress area for prying.

The BK15, BK16, BK17 are all avail right now, in the laser etched "First Production Run" & with "Ethan Beckers" signature also laser etched into the blade. GOOD GOD MAN, where have you been ? LOL :D Only avail at one place, the knife superstore that is in Sevierville Tennesse.

The regular ones will be out April 1st, or there abouts. The BK16 FPR has a sabre grind, where as the production one will have a full flat grind.
